Output 38d62d583bd898210da4c77f750e39a12a35496be82837a31e23cc987e4f39f7:2

value
2026462
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7119a8bc57dea00810b138798dbcc79a64d5cd1a OP_EQUAL
address
3C1323ixy5Hb6v2YcSzbZ3Z1P56u8bBqKb
transaction
38d62d583bd898210da4c77f750e39a12a35496be82837a31e23cc987e4f39f7
spent
true